Program Analysis

Your theological and ministerial studies at Moody Bible Institute benefit significantly from its established reputation within Christian circles and its prime Chicago location. This combination provides graduates with a strong network and access to a diverse metropolitan job market, which can translate into better placement opportunities in various ministry, educational, and faith-based non-profit roles. The program likely emphasizes practical leadership, communication, and spiritual formation, equipping you for direct service in churches, parachurch organizations, or as educators. While careers in this field are inherently service-oriented rather than high-income, Moody's strong institutional connections help graduates secure positions slightly above the national average for similar programs. Furthermore, the deeply human and relational aspects of these roles ensure your skills remain highly valued and resistant to automation. About Moody Bible Institute

Moody Bible Institute accepts 98% of applicants — an open-access institution by design, a compact campus enrolling 1,586 students in Chicago, IL.
